Be careful when looking at hosting packages with unlimited services. For example, unlimited space plans often include fine print on the kinds of files that that space will support. Also, infinite bandwidth might be considered to be tiered payment plans. Ensure that your information regarding each plan is complete, and never assume that “unlimited” services come without strings attached.

Many website hosting services rely on the services of larger companies. Those companies buy large quantities of server space, and then rent it out at a premium to small sites. Find out if your web host is renting space from another host. If so, contact the larger host and get a quote for hosting services so that you can determine which hosting service will give you the best deal.

You should consider the server access privileges you are afforded by any potential web host. Some providers use basic control panels to direct server access; others feature complex, customizable FTP-based access. A simple site can be hosted with nothing more than cPanel, but a complex site requires at least FTP access and sometimes SSH.
